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2012.02.19;
Скачать: CL | DM;

Вниз

3d визуализация   Найти похожие ветки 

 
Ega23 ©   (2011-11-02 12:19) [40]


> ИМХО, задача далеко не ламерская.


Задача не ламерская. Подход к решению ламерский. После такого и складывается впечатление, что delphi-программисты клянчат на форумах компоненты под любую задачу.

А решений масса, я по студенчеству такую фигню на канве самостоятельно отрисовывал. Поверхность (всякие там эллиптические гиперболоиды) формулой задавалась, потом отрисовывалась, с возможностью вращения вокруг всех трёх осей с возможностью зума по каждой. Это если свой велосипед изобретать, либо разобраться с математикой (как у меня в курсовике).
Можно GLScene прикрутить, там всё это дело уже реализовано.
Можно с FireMonkey поиграться, наверняка там это тоже уже реализовано (сам я не пробовал, только демки на ютубе смотрел).
Можно с DirectX поиграться.

Но это надо что-то делать, а не TVraschayschiysyaKubik на форуме просить, не так ли?


 
И. Павел ©   (2011-11-02 12:23) [41]

> вращение с таймера иле че там его крутит,переносим та трекбар
> или мышь в окне,с размерами тож не проблем

Трекбарами или напрямую мышью без привязки будет на порядок менее удобно, чем непосредственно тянуть за объект. Если объект один - пойдет, но если 100 - юзер сойдет с ума.
То же самое, что работать в дизайнере форм Delphi только через инспектор объектов, не трогая саму форму.


 
QAZ   (2011-11-02 12:43) [42]

Удалено модератором


 
QAZ   (2011-11-02 12:52) [43]

на сурсфорже даже 3д редактор на дельфе живет уже лет 7


 
alexdn ©   (2011-11-02 13:15) [44]

сейчас кстати такое входит в моду в интернет-магазинах, посмотреть товар со всех старон http://avtogsm.ru/avtonavigatori-s-videovhodom-c339.html там тоже вообщем вращение вокруг одной оси, вот и мне нужно что то вроде, только для простого обьекта...


 
alexdn ©   (2011-11-02 13:17) [45]

вот ещё http://3dstudio.in.ua/


 
QAZ   (2011-11-02 13:29) [46]


> alexdn ©   (02.11.11 13:15) [44]

есть кстати такая модная тенденция делать программы аля "3д коробка мейкер"
это из этой оперы?


 
Leon-Z ©   (2011-11-02 15:34) [47]

В учебнике Михаила Краснова "OpenGL в Delhi" в одной из последних
глав рассматривается пример создания 3D - редактора моделей.
Тот редактор не только кубик может повращать, и не только повращать,
но и другие 3D - объекты.

Качай, покупай книгу, садись читай, разбирайся, развивайтся.
Изучишь один раз - и на все времена хватит.

PS. Чтобы в следующий раз не нужен был TВращающийсяКубик.


 
Anatoly Podgoretsky ©   (2011-11-02 15:40) [48]

> Leon-Z  (02.11.2011 15:34:47)  [47]

http://www.podgoretsky.com/ftp/Docs/Delphi/OpenGLDelphi/


 
QAZ   (2011-11-02 16:50) [49]


> Anatoly Podgoretsky ©   (02.11.11 15:40) [48]

аяяй как нехорошо,в турьму однозначно


 
Kerk ©   (2011-11-02 20:58) [50]

There"s a new white paper on FireMonkey available from the RAD in Action - FireMonkey page. You can download the whitepaper from  http://forms.embarcadero.com/forms/AMUSCA1110FireMonkey-MarcoCantuWhitepaper


 
БарЛог ©   (2011-11-03 08:55) [51]

> Ты скажи уж сразу, какой следующий этап будет?

углы спилить :)


 
alexdn ©   (2011-11-03 21:54) [52]

> БарЛог ©   (03.11.11 08:55) [51]
> > Ты скажи уж сразу, какой следующий этап будет?
>
> углы спилить :)
причём левый нижний :)


 
alexdn ©   (2011-11-04 08:29) [53]

Вот так задача была решена, кому интересно

изображение http://s017.radikal.ru/i408/1111/92/1451a2985090.jpg
скачать проект http://ifolder.ru/26744943

при этом потребовалась ровно одна! строчка кода:

Cube2.RotationAngle.z:=ArcDial1.value;

вот поэтому я и просил компонент TВращающийсяКубик :)..


 
alexdn ©   (2011-11-04 08:33) [54]

да, кстати, кто подскажет более красивое решение буду рад услышать


 
alexdn ©   (2011-11-04 09:09) [55]

вот более продвинутый вариант http://ifolder.ru/26745338 но что мне не нравится, так это то, что битмап ставится на все 4 стороны одновременно



Страницы: 1 2 вся ветка

Текущий архив: 2012.02.19;
Скачать: CL | DM;

Наверх




Память: 0.56 MB
Время: 0.012 c
15-1319778083
prestig
2011-10-28 09:01
2012.02.19
файл hosts


2-1320310497
Laguna
2011-11-03 11:54
2012.02.19
Предосмотр картинки на форме


15-1319920202
Юрий
2011-10-30 00:30
2012.02.19
С днем рождения ! 30 октября 2011 воскресенье


15-1319715427
Бездомный
2011-10-27 15:37
2012.02.19
Как лучше называть ключевое (и не только) поля таблиц?


13-1127735614
MeF Dei Corvi
2005-09-26 15:53
2012.02.19
Получение информации о системе